S. Mark Overholt, M.D.
Undergraduate Education
Stanford University, Stanford CA
Medical School
Doctor of Medicine
Baylor College of Medicine, Houston, TX
Residency
General Surgery – Baylor College of Medicine, Houston, TX
Otolaryngology – Baylor College of Medicine, Houston, TX
Mark grew up in Knoxville, Tennessee, and went to Webb School of Knoxville for High School and Stanford University
As a general otolaryngologist and head and neck surgeon, like many others in the team, he sees patients for half of the day and operates the other half of the day.
Serving as president of the group, he is involved in administration decisions and planning, ensuring the ENT practice is always striving for success.
He believes his partners are all well-educated and compassionate physicians and finds it a joy to practice caring for the wonderful people of East Tennessee.
Nothing fulfills Mark more than solving a problem for a patient who has been suffering for a while, whether it is as simple as letting them breathe more easily, stopping their sinus infections, or walking through their cancer journey towards a cure.
Mark loves his job and is honored to walk out the door with a smile on his face each day.
